The Vans LX Classic Slip-On 98 Trainers are designed for adults seeking a versatile, timeless footwear option that excels in casual, everyday settings. These iconic trainers offer the convenience of a slip-on design combined with a durable construction, making them a reliable choice for daily wear; however, users should note that they lack the adjustable lace-up support found in traditional athletic sneakers.

These trainers are ready to wear straight out of the box. Because they are slip-ons, no initial adjustment is required, though you may prefer to use a shoe horn during the first few wears to protect the heel counter. To keep them looking fresh, spot clean the canvas upper with a mild detergent and a soft brush. Avoid machine washing, which can compromise the adhesive bonds. If the rubber sidewalls become scuffed, a damp cloth with a bit of baking soda is usually sufficient to restore their brightness.
